John Harrison is a retired Special Agent of the Internal Revenue Service, Criminal Investigation Division. He has broad experience conducting financial investigations involving narcotics, homicide, political corruption, organized crime, money laundering, Ponzi schemes, e-gambling, outlaw gangs, terrorism financing, digital forensic evidence, espionage, foreign and domestic forfeiture and all types of financial fraud. Prior to the IRS, John was a police officer for the Wayne County Sheriff, Detroit, Michigan for a year. He began his career with the IRS as a Special Agent in the Detroit office after graduating from the University of Michigan. During his 33 year career with the US Treasury, John was involved in many projects of strategic importance to the United States including assignments with the FBI Joint Counter Terrorism Task Force (post 9/11), the IRS Mountain States Organized Crime Drug Enforcement Tax Force and as Supervisory Special Agent for his region. John is an esteemed member of many forensic and fraud examiner societies.
